Ouanaham vs Bridgeport/ Sikorsky Memorial, Ct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Ouanaham, New Caledonia and Bridgeport/ Sikorsky Memorial, Ct, Usa is approximately 13,961 km or 8,675 mi.
  • To reach Ouanaham in this distance one would set out from Bridgeport/ Sikorsky Memorial, Ct bearing 272.6°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Ouanaham bearing 233.5° or SW .
  • Ouanaham has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Bridgeport/ Sikorsky Memorial, Ct has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• The average annual temperature is 11.8 °C (21.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.6 °C (33.5°F) less in Ouanaham.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 693.6 mm (27.3 in) more which is equivalent to 693.6 l/m² (17.02 US gal/ft²) or 6,936,000 l/ha (741,504 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.9° higher in Ouanaham than in Bridgeport/ Sikorsky Memorial, Ct.
